A full-scale investigation of roughness lengths in inhomogeneous terrain and a comparison of wind prediction models for transitional flow regimes

Abstract/Summary:
Models for estimating the mean and gust wind speeds in the transitional flow regime are investigated and compared to full-scale measurements. Displacement heights and roughness lengths are also investigated for each data collection location. Roughness lengths are calculated from full-scale data using conservation of mass and turbulence intensity methods. These values are compared to wind tunnel, visual inspection and roughness element based methods. The displacement height is also estimated from conservation of mass and compared to roughness element based methods.
